Abstract: | The study of the directly contact toxicity of crude leaf essential oils of Peganum harmala L. (Zygophyllaceae), Cleome arabica L. (Capparidaceae) and Cymbopogon schoenanthus L. (Poaceae) collected in the Algerian Sahara, on the fifth stage larvae (L5) and adults of desert locusts, reveals their toxicity in this locust. For crude essential oils of P. harmala, a mortality rate of 100% is reached after 8 mn 30', in L5 larvae treated. It is 12 mn 10' for C. Arabica and 35 mn 11' for C. schoenanthus. A 100% mortality is reached in imago treated after 30 mn 18', 128 mn 40', 63 mn 19 et for P. harmala, C. arabica and C. schoenanthus respectively. No deaths recorded at the level of L5 larvae and adult forms of the control groups. L5 larvae appear to be more sensitive to the raw leaf essential oils of these plants acridifuges tested compared to adult individuals.
